Cristian Salomoni is a criminalist expert in nonverbal communication, and the director of the IIAC–International Behavior Analysis Institute. Throughout his career, the goal of his work has been to help others improve their communication when speaking in public and presenting projects, or to help them understand and approach different types of clients based on their professional profiles.
Cristian shares his knowledge and expertise by teaching classes and training courses at different universities and institutes. He currently teaches at the International School of Criminology and Criminalistics in the master's program on nonverbal communication and lie detection and also offers a wide variety of courses at the IIAC. When he's not teaching, Cristian collaborates with national and international media outlets by analyzing and writing about public figures. He has also been featured on segments about communication like Sin decir ni pío on Spanish Radio Nacional, Giù la Maschera on Italian TV station La7, Sin palabras on the Spanish show Código Nuevo, and in Wall Street International.
